meta-aspeed: drop thud compatibility
From the manual on LAYERSERIES_COMPAT:
Lists the versions of the OpenEmbedded-Core for which a layer is
compatible. Using the LAYERSERIES_COMPAT variable allows the layer
maintainer to indicate which combinations of the layer and OE-Core can
be expected to work. The variable gives the system a way to detect when
a layer has not been tested with new releases of OE-Core (e.g. the layer
is not maintained).
Noone is testing OE-core thud + meta-aspeed master, so take the safe
route and don't advertise support. For compatibility with OE-core thud,
use the thud branch of meta-aspeed.
